Types of AI-Powered Tools for Process Optimization
AI-powered tools for process optimization can be broadly categorized into two types: workflow automation and predictive maintenance.
- Workflow Automation: This involves using AI to automate repetitive tasks, such as data entry, document processing, and customer service requests. AI-powered workflow automation tools can learn from business processes and identify areas where automation can be applied, resulting in significant productivity gains and cost savings.
- Predictive Maintenance: This involves using AI and machine learning algorithms to predict when equipment or machinery will require maintenance, reducing downtime and increasing overall operational efficiency. Predictive maintenance tools can analyze data from sensors, machines, and other sources to identify potential issues before they become major problems.
Predictive maintenance is a crucial aspect of process optimization, especially in industries where downtime can have significant financial implications. By predicting maintenance needs, businesses can schedule maintenance during off-peak hours, reduce energy consumption, and prolong the lifespan of equipment.

Challenges and Limitations of Implementing AI-Enabled Customer Experiences
While AI tools offer many benefits, they also present several challenges and limitations, including:
* Data security: AI tools require access to sensitive customer data, which must be protected from unauthorized access and misuse.
* Biases: AI algorithms can perpetuate existing biases and stereotypes, leading to unfair treatment of certain customer groups.
* Complexity: AI tools can be complex and difficult to integrate into existing systems, requiring significant technical expertise and resources.
* Cost: Implementing and maintaining AI tools can be expensive, requiring significant investment in infrastructure, training, and support.

Threat Detection and Security Information and Event Management
AI-powered threat detection tools can analyze vast amounts of data in real-time, identifying potential security threats before they occur. These tools use machine learning algorithms to detect patterns and anomalies, enabling businesses to respond quickly to potential threats. Security information and event management (SIEM) tools, on the other hand, collect and analyze log data from various sources, providing real-time visibility into security events and potential threats. This allows businesses to detect and respond to security incidents in a more efficient and effective manner.
Threat Prevention, Vulnerability Management, and Incident Response
AI tools play a crucial role in threat prevention, vulnerability management, and incident response. For instance, AI-powered tools can analyze network traffic and detect potential threats in real-time, blocking malicious traffic before it reaches the network. Vulnerability management tools use AI-powered scan techniques to identify vulnerabilities in software and systems, enabling businesses to patch and remediate vulnerabilities before they are exploited by attackers. In the event of a security incident, AI-powered incident response tools can analyze the incident and provide recommendations on how to respond and remediate the situation.
